    Understanding Sentiment Analysis in Influencer Programs

    Sentiment analysis is the process of evaluating text to determine the emotional tone behind it, such as positive, negative, or neutral feelings. For influencer programs, this means analyzing both influencer-generated and audience-generated content regarding your brand. A robust sentiment metric dives deeper than vanity metrics like likes or shares. By capturing nuanced opinions, marketers gain a 360-degree view of how influencer campaigns shape brand perception.

    Collecting and Preparing Influencer Data for Sentiment Metrics

    The foundation of any strong sentiment score is high-quality, comprehensive data. Start by collecting:

    • Influencer content: Posts, stories, videos, captions, and comments where your brand is mentioned.
    • Audience reactions: Comments and replies beneath influencer posts, including emojis or contextual slang unique to 2025.
    • Meta data: Post dates, engagement rates, audience demographics, and sentiment-rich hashtags.

    Use social listening tools and influencer platforms to aggregate this data. Clean and preprocess the text by removing spam, irrelevant content, or duplicate entries, and standardize language. Consider regional nuances and trending lingo among your target demographics for more accurate sentiment scoring.

    Designing a Scalable Brand Sentiment Score System

    To create a brand sentiment framework at scale, choose a blend of manual and automated methods:

    • Manual review: For new campaigns or niche topics, human evaluators can spot context or sarcasm that machines might miss.
    • Natural Language Processing (NLP): Use AI frameworks trained for brand and influencer contexts, capable of interpreting slang, emojis, and multi-language content prevalent in 2025.
    • Custom lexicon: Customize sentiment dictionaries to recognize product-specific jargon, influencer catchphrases, and evolving social vernacular.

    Assign weighted scores for each content piece—for example, +1 for positive, 0 for neutral, -1 for negative. Calculate aggregate and average sentiment scores across posts and campaigns, factoring in post reach and engagement level to prioritize high-impact mentions.

    Validating and Refining Your Influencer Sentiment Model

    Continuous improvement is vital for influencer sentiment analysis accuracy. Validate your sentiment algorithm by:

    • Comparing machine outputs with human judgment: Regularly review random samples to recalibrate when discrepancies occur.
    • Tracking changes over time: Monitor trends before and after key campaigns or influencer collaborations. A sharp sentiment swing may indicate brand issues or influencer mismatches.
    • Soliciting feedback: Engage both internal teams and select influencers to share subjective impressions compared to your scores.

    Refine your sentiment model as language evolves or when launching in new markets. Leverage user suggestions and new AI capabilities to ensure your sentiment score reflects current conversations and cultural realities.

    Leveraging Sentiment Scores to Optimize Brand-Invested Influencer Programs

    With a robust brand sentiment score in hand, maximize influencer program impact by:

    • Identifying top-performing influencers: Prioritize partnerships with advocates who consistently generate positive, high-impact sentiment, not just high reach.
    • Spotting risks early: Detect negative waves around certain influencers or product launches in near real-time, enabling quick corrective actions.
    • Benchmarking influencer campaigns: Compare sentiment scores across different influencer tiers, content types, and platforms to understand what resonates best with your audience.
    • Reporting actionable outcomes: Share findings with stakeholders using clear visualizations to demonstrate ROI beyond standard engagement metrics.

    Integrating Sentiment Data With Broader Brand Performance Metrics

    For holistic brand health tracking, integrate your sentiment scores with:

    • Sales data: Track correlations between positive sentiment spikes and product purchase surges following influencer activations.
    • Share of voice: Gauge the proportion of favorable sentiment mentions versus competitors.
    • Crisis management dashboards: Set sentiment-based alerts to catch emerging issues before they escalate into wider PR concerns.

    Layering sentiment with other KPIs empowers your marketing and PR teams to make agile, evidence-based decisions. Over time, brands see clearer patterns in what drives not just awareness—but deep, positive associations with your name.

    FAQs: Building and Using Sentiment Scores in Influencer Marketing

    • What is a sentiment score in influencer marketing?

      A sentiment score quantifies the positivity, negativity, or neutrality of conversations and content about your brand across influencer campaigns, providing a nuanced measure of public perception.

    • How accurate are AI-powered sentiment tools in 2025?

      AI-driven sentiment analysis has significantly improved in 2025, especially for handling social media slang and multilingual content. However, occasional human oversight is recommended for context-sensitive topics.

    • Can sentiment scores predict influencer campaign success?

      While not the sole predictor, positive sentiment trends correlate strongly with successful influencer campaigns, especially when linked with engagement and sales data.

    • What’s the best way to present sentiment score data to executives?

      Use visual dashboards showing score trends, influencer comparisons, and links to key business outcomes like sales or brand health improvements.

    • How frequently should I recalculate my influencer sentiment scores?

      For active campaigns, update sentiment scores in near real-time or at least weekly, allowing for rapid response to emerging trends or issues.
